Welcome to the Quellhorn review rotation! The piece you'll see most often is Dedupe-o-tron, our on-call alert deduplicator. It hashes alert fingerprints over a sliding five-minute window and collapses duplicates before they hit the pager. When reviewing changes, watch for anything that touches the fingerprint function — even a tiny tweak can split or merge alert groups in surprising ways, so always ask for a replay test against last week's alert archive. The replay harness docs and reviewer checklist are on the internal wiki here:

wiki page, fajof-tajef: https://vault.tolvaqio.corp/board/pipeline/pages/ticket/c20d7f984bcc9e12

## Step 4: Enable soft deletes on orders

Add the `deleted_at` column to `orders` in Cartwheel's primary database, backfill NULLs, then flip the application flag so reads filter deleted rows. Do not drop the old purge job until step 6. Apply the following configuration to the orders service before restarting workers.

config for bafof-tajef:
[silion]
port = 5000
team = silmir
host = silion.crelvonet.internal
region = lower-3
access_code = ac_1f1b57
timeout_ms = 2000

Splitline, our experiment assignment service, now hashes unit IDs with a salted bucket scheme to keep assignments sticky across deploys. Per last week's sync, we verified that reassignment churn stays under 0.2% when salts rotate. Variant weights are resolved at request time from the cached config. The current tuning constants are as follows.

limits module of yagaf-fadup:
BUDGETS = {
    "oliys": 156,
    "zormir": 47,
    "frawyn": 544,
}